diff options
Diffstat (limited to 'lib/compilers')
-rw-r--r-- | lib/compilers/argument-parsers.js |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/compilers/argument-parsers.js b/lib/compilers/argument-parsers.js index 05f52a7ad..b2914b7ab 100644 --- a/lib/compilers/argument-parsers.js +++ b/lib/compilers/argument-parsers.js @@ -31,7 +31,7 @@ class BaseParser { return compiler.exec(compiler.compiler.exe, [helpArg]).then(result => { const options = {}; if (result.code === 0) { - const optionFinder = /^\s*(--?[a-z0-9=,[\]<>|-]*)\s*(.*)/i; + const optionFinder = /^\s*(--?[a-z0-9=+,[\]<>|-]*)\s*(.*)/i; let previousOption = false; utils.eachLine(result.stdout + result.stderr, line => { @@ -47,7 +47,7 @@ class BaseParser { previousOption = match[1]; options[previousOption] = { - description: match[2], + description: match[2].trim(), timesused: 0 }; }); |